Description
Welcome to the Fairtrade Tea Café which happens every Sunday at The Students' Union.
We have a variety of free fairtrade and organic tea for you to try that all come in plant based biodegradable tea bags. It might even encourage you to change your home supplier of tea.
Blends to choose from:
- Black Tea - Classis Everyday - A blend of the finest Fairtrade teas grown in the rich red soils of Africa and the fertile soils of India, for a full, classic flavour.
- Black Tea - Organic Decaf - A wonderfully full and rich brew, blended with Assam, gently decaffeinated the natural way.
- Black Tea - Organic English Breakfast - A majestic blend starring full-bodied Assam and wonderfully delicate Ceylon for a refreshing finish.
- Green Tea - Organic Pure Green Tea - This light and delicate pure green tea, with a bright golden colour, tastes as good as it looks in the cup.
- And perhaps a few surprises along the way....
We are committed to sustainability so please bring your reusable hot drinks cup there are no single use cups available.
The tea is free and there is no need to book in advance - open to all UWE Bristol students.
